WEBDec 14, 2020 · To make the pizzelle cookies, beat the egg, egg white, and sugar, and then stir in the wet ingredients (butter, milk, and vanilla). …

1. In a large bowl, beat egg, egg white and sugar until thick.
2. Stir in the melted butter, milk and vanilla.
3. Sift together the flour and baking powder, and blend into the batter until smooth.
4. Heat the pizzelle iron. Lightly spray iron with oil.
